you roll a die with the sample space s = {1, 2, 3, 4, 5, 6}. you define a as {1, 3, 5}, b as {2, 3, 4, 5, 6}, c as {4, 5}, and d as {3, 5, 6}. determine which of the following events are exhaustive and/or mutually exclusive.\n a. a and b\n b. a and c\n c. a and d\n d. b and c\n exhaustive\n mutually exclusive
Answer
Explanation:
Step1: Recall definitions
Exhaustive events: Their union is the sample - space. Mutually exclusive events: They have no common elements.
Step2: Analyze A and B
$A={1,3,5}$, $B = {2,3,4,5,6}$. $A\cup B={1,2,3,4,5,6}=S$, but $A\cap B = {3,5}\neq\varnothing$, so not mutually exclusive.
Step3: Analyze A and C
$A={1,3,5}$, $C={4,5}$. $A\cup C={1,3,4,5}\neq S$, and $A\cap C = {5}\neq\varnothing$, so neither exhaustive nor mutually exclusive.
Step4: Analyze A and D
$A={1,3,5}$, $D={3,5,6}$. $A\cup D={1,3,5,6}\neq S$, and $A\cap D={3,5}\neq\varnothing$, so neither exhaustive nor mutually exclusive.
Step5: Analyze B and C
$B = {2,3,4,5,6}$, $C={4,5}$. $B\cup C={2,3,4,5,6}\neq S$, and $B\cap C={4,5}\neq\varnothing$, so neither exhaustive nor mutually exclusive.
Answer:
None of the given pairs are both exhaustive and mutually exclusive.
